Fiona Johnston exits dentsu

Fiona Johnston has been made redundant in a company restructure. 

UM promotes Andrew Clift to general manager

UM Australia has promoted Andrew Clift to general manager of its Sydney office. He was previously managing partner. 

Hiranthi Jayaweera departs Carat NSW

Hiranthi ‘Harry’ Jayaweera will depart her role as managing director at Carat NSW. 

Ex-Nine CMO Liana Dubois lands MD role at Entertainment Partners 

Entertainment Partners has appointed Liana Dubois to managing director for Australia and New Zealand. 

ACM promotes Molly Jolly to group sales manager

Molly Jolly has been promoted to group sales manager, national sales. 

Digitas appoints Kate Warren-Smith managing director

Kate Warren-Smith has joined marketing, technology and digital agency, Digitas as managing director. 

ARN's Jessica Steliou to head Mamamia sales in WA

Mamamia expands Western Australian marketing appointing Jessica Steliou to the newly created role of head of sales for the region.

QMS appoints Ben Gibb sales director for New Zealand

QMS has appointed Ben Gibb national sales director for New Zealand. He joins from sports entertainment network, Sky New Zealand where he was head of ad sales. 

Blobfish appoints Mayvelynn Nurimba campaign co-ordinator 

Advertising and brand activation agency, Blobfish International, has appointed Mayvelynn Nurimba campaign co-ordinator. Nurimba will support global operations in New Zealand, the UK and Australia. 

Colenso BBDO adds James Bennett to leadership team

Adveritising agency Colenso BBDO has appointed James Bennett group planning director and deputy head of planning. He was previously at Wieden+Kennedy London.

DARKHORSE expands 

Brand experience and communications agency DARKHORSE expanded the team with Frankie Gair re-joining  the agency as business director and Isabella Ireland, previously of Studio Messa, as senior producer.
